In this role, you will own the program objectives for our direct-to-disposition program, working at the intersection of product innovation, operations optimization, and supply chain transformation. You will collaborate with product managers, program managers, software developers, vendor managers, and internal and third-party operations stakeholders to build solutions that fundamentally change how we process returns. You will have end-to-end visibility across the return supply chain and the opportunity to innovate on behalf of our customers at scale.
Key job responsibilities
Drive program objectives through effective program management, project planning, implementation oversight, and development of processes and documentation. This includes onboarding new partners with innovative capabilities and configuring returns injections in the direct-to-disposition program.
Design and scale services and tools that grow with business volume and complexity. This includes ownership of the program to implement total recovery optimized logic at return creation to route returns efficiently to their final disposition.
Develop and track key performance indicators and service level agreements. This includes supporting xBR, periodic status updates, and creation of benchmark data.
Lead cross-functional communication for program updates, policies, and processes
Drive resolution of critical customer issues through root cause analysis
Negotiate and establish efficient processes across partner teams to eliminate dependencies and defects
